The
Fleet and Family Readiness (FFR) division of Commander, Navy Installations
Command (CNIC) provides a variety of
installation support services to the worldwide Navy community, including recreational
and leisure programs. These programs are offered through Morale, Welfare and
Recreation
(MWR) and Child and Youth Programs
(CYP) to sailors, their families, military
reservists, retirees and authorized civilian employees. We operate in 23 states,
the District of Columbia, and 11 countries abroad, employing recreation, child
and youth, hospitality, sports and fitness professionals around the globe.
